When we speak to another individual or group, the distance
our bodies are physically apart also communicates a message. Most
of us are unaware for the importance of space in communication until【S1】______
we are confronting with someone who uses it differently. For【S2】______
instance, we all have a sense of which is a comfortable interaction【S3】______
distance to a person with whom we are speaking. If that person gets
closer than the distance in which we are comfortable, we usually【S4】______
automatically back up to reestablish our comfort zone. Similarly, if
we feel that we are too far away from the person we are talking to,
we likely to close the distance between us. If two speakers have【S5】______
different comfortable interaction distances, a ballet of shifting
positions usually occurs until one of the individuals is backed into a
corner and feels threatened with what may be perceived【S6】______
like hostile. As a result, the verbal message may not be listened to【S7】______
or understood as it is intended.【S8】______
Comfort in interaction distance mostly has to do with the
distance between faces that are looking directly at each other. Most
people do not have the same feeling about physical closeness if they
do not have eyes contact. In a crowd or an elevator, people usually【S9】______
choose to not to look at anyone in order to avoid feeling.【S10】______
【S3】
选项
答案
which—what
解析
关系代词误用。根据上下文可知,此处应该使用的关系代词是what而不是which,what既作介词of的宾语,又作从句的主语。此处意为“例如,在同别人交谈时,对于什么是一个舒适的互动距离,我们都有一定的感知。”
